Transaction d34316a87b5b6a51b3d8764cd7655d3d30d2b4c59ed1046e129003bf7c7008e2
1 Input
1 Output
-
d34316a87b5b6a51b3d8764cd7655d3d30d2b4c59ed1046e129003bf7c7008e2:0
- value
- 644572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dc8c488ef0300a09801d6dcc2361cb5d76673ee OP_EQUAL
- address
- 3BhW63CBCLUaSLLN3scBwZXzkrz4tjMsPw